// CATALOG_CACHE_TTL_SECONDS
// Yes, this number looks arbitrary — it isn't. The Pinwharf catalog
// invalidates on price updates via events, but the event bus drops
// messages during regional failover, so this TTL is the backstop.
// Shorten it and the origin DB cries; lengthen it and stale prices
// leak into checkout. 900 was the compromise after the spring incident.
// If you change it, rerun the soak test and note the build token
// it prints, recorded below for the current value.

pipeline stamp: htk9_ce63042d9

# Quotas: Pictogrove Image Cache Bounds

The Pictogrove thumbnail cache previously grew without bound because eviction keyed on entry count, not byte size, allowing oversized decoded bitmaps to accumulate until the process was OOM-killed. The fix enforces a hard byte ceiling, per-entry size cap, and idle eviction sweep. These bounds also limit memory-exhaustion abuse from attacker-supplied images. The enforced values are as follows.

tuning constants:
QUOTAS = {
    "druwyn": 5,
    "holix": 5,
    "zorath": 5,
    "holwyn": 10,
}

Pay particular attention to how plugin-reported errors are wrapped before reaching callers, since several past regressions came from plugins throwing raw exceptions across the boundary. The capability reference, error-wrapping rules, and the compatibility policy for third-party validators are all kept on the internal page below.

dashboard of yahaf-kajep = https://jira.zemvarsys.internal/display/projects/browse/browse/a08b